It's not a done deal, but the Chicago Bears have shifted their focus for a new stadium back to the massive Arlington Heights property they purchased in 2023, backing away from a controversial proposal for a new lakefront stadium in Chicago.

The new mayor of Arlington Heights, Illinois, got to work before he even took the oath of office on Monday. Mayor James Tinaglia is an architect who served as village trustee for 12 years. He met with Chicago Bears president and CEO Kevin Warren on Monday before taking the oath of office.

Around 3:45 p.m. Tuesday, a bus from KinderCare in Arlington Heights picked up a 5-year-old girl named Dior after school to take her to daycare. But when Dior's mom went to pick her up around 6 p.m., daycare workers said they never saw the girl. The mom then rushed back to the bus, opened the emergency door, and found her daughter limp and cold to the touch.
